Wise picks up ground in Featured Race, finishes 10th

You just can’t keep a great driver behind. JJ Wise said that they didn’t do very well during the hot laps. “We started the Feature Race in seventeenth position.”

During the Feature, Wise was able to make his way up to eighth position when his tire was sliced and he was forced off the track to get it fixed. Steve Gauley, mechanic for the Porter Team, “I saw JJ Wise’s dad run to the trailer to get another tire, it looked like he could use some help, so I went over to assist him.”

“We had to go back on the track in last position, but we still finished tenth,” Wise said with a smile. “It’s okay, we’re still high on the points list.” Wise did add that when a tire is slashed, it is really hard to keep air in it.

The United States Modified Touring Series (USMTS) will make a return to I-35 Speedway Tuesday Night.

Winners for the June 19m, 2011 Races are:

Modifieds-Jeremy Mills
Stock Cars-Derek Green
Sport Mods-Adam Ackerman
Hobby Stocks-Chad Gentz
Hornets-Jordon Prehn
Jr. Hornets-Chanse Hollatz
